https://github.com/thekartikeyamishra/trendtracker-ai
TrendTracker AI is an AI-powered tool that helps social media influencers stay ahead of trends by analyzing real-time data and suggesting viral content ideas tailored to their niche.
https://github.com/thekartikeyamishra/trendtracker-ai
ai ai-agents expo expressjs lottie-animation nodejs openai-gpt4 react-native
Last synced: about 2 months ago
JSON representation
TrendTracker AI is an AI-powered tool that helps social media influencers stay ahead of trends by analyzing real-time data and suggesting viral content ideas tailored to their niche.
- Host: GitHub
- URL: https://github.com/thekartikeyamishra/trendtracker-ai
- Owner: thekartikeyamishra
- Created: 2025-02-11T17:54:26.000Z (3 months ago)
- Default Branch: main
- Last Pushed: 2025-02-11T18:39:06.000Z (3 months ago)
- Last Synced: 2025-02-11T18:49:13.140Z (3 months ago)
- Topics: ai, ai-agents, expo, expressjs, lottie-animation, nodejs, openai-gpt4, react-native
- Language: JavaScript
- Homepage:
- Size: 0 Bytes
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# π TrendTracker AI - Your AI-Powered Social Media Insights π
**TrendTracker AI** is an AI-powered tool that helps social media influencers stay ahead of trends by analyzing real-time data and suggesting viral content ideas tailored to their niche.
π₯ **Discover the latest trends, generate content ideas, and dominate social media with AI!**
---
## **β¨ Features**
### π **Trending Topics Analysis**
- Get **real-time trending topics** across social media platforms.
- AI-powered **trend tracking** for Twitter, Instagram, and YouTube.
- Stay ahead with **daily trending insights**.### π‘ **AI-Powered Content Ideas**
- Generate **viral content ideas** based on your niche.
- Get **engagement-driven** topics to create trending posts, videos, and reels.### π **Demographic Insights**
- Understand your audience with **AI-powered niche analysis**.
- Find **targeted demographics**, interests, and trending hashtags.### π¨ **Modern UI & UX with Animations**
- Beautiful, **engaging UI with Lottie animations** for a seamless experience.
- **Dark mode & light mode** support for accessibility.### π€ **GPT-4 Powered AI Assistance**
- Integrated with **OpenAI's GPT-4 API** for intelligent insights.
- **Smart AI chatbot** to provide tips on audience engagement.---
## **π§ Tech Stack**
| **Category** | **Technology Used** |
|-------------|---------------------|
| **Frontend** | React Native (Expo) |
| **Backend** | Node.js, Express.js |
| **Database** | Firebase Firestore |
| **AI** | OpenAI's GPT-4 |
| **UI/UX** | Lottie Animations, Styled Components |---
## **π Installation & Setup**
### 1οΈβ£ Clone the Repository
```bash
git clone https://github.com/thekartikeyamishra/trendtracker-ai.git
cd trendtracker-ai
```### 2οΈβ£ Install Dependencies
```bash
npm install
```### 3οΈβ£ Set Up Environment Variables
Create a `.env` file and add:
```plaintext
OPENAI_API_KEY=your_openai_api_key
```### 4οΈβ£ Start the Development Server
```bash
npx expo start
```π **Scan the QR Code** in Expo Go or open it on your device.
---
## **π How It Works**
1οΈβ£ **Choose Your Niche** π―
2οΈβ£ **Get AI-Generated Trends & Ideas** π‘
3οΈβ£ **Analyze Audience Insights** π
4οΈβ£ **Create Viral Content & Dominate Social Media** π---
## **π― Use Cases**
β **For Influencers:** Stay ahead with AI-powered **trending topics & content ideas**.
β **For Marketers:** Get AI-based **audience insights** for engagement.
β **For Brands:** Understand **demographics & viral trends** to enhance brand reach.
β **For Social Media Enthusiasts:** Never run out of ideas with **AI-powered trend suggestions**.---
## **π οΈ Future Enhancements**
πΉ **Auto-Scheduling AI-Generated Content**
πΉ **Deep Learning for Predicting Future Trends**
πΉ **Integration with Instagram, Twitter, and YouTube APIs**
πΉ **AI-Powered Caption & Hashtag Generator**---
## **π€ Contribution Guidelines**
1. **Fork the repository**
2. **Create a feature branch**
```bash
git checkout -b feature-name
```
3. **Commit your changes**
```bash
git commit -m "Added feature-name"
```
4. **Push to your branch**
```bash
git push origin feature-name
```
5. **Open a Pull Request**---
## **π’ Support & Feedback**
π¬ **Have suggestions?** Open an issue on GitHub!
π **Love this project?** Star the repo & share with your friends!π **Letβs revolutionize social media trend tracking with AI!** ππ₯
---
## **π License**
This project is licensed under the **MIT License** β feel free to use and modify it!---